About SRR 

The Conference of State Bank Supervisors (CSBS) in cooperation with the American Association of Residential Mortgage Regulators (AARMR) established the State Regulatory Registry LLC (SRR) on September 29, 2006. A limited-liability company, SRR is to develop and operate nationwide systems for state regulators in the financial services industry. Such systems are intended to enhance state’s ability to protect consumers; improve supervision and enforcement of licensed entities; and streamline licensing and other processes for state agencies and the industry through the use of modern technology and centralizing redundant state agency operations.

SRR currently owns and operates the Nationwide Mortgage Licensing System & Registry (NMLS) that has been developed by state mortgage regulators. NMLS began operations on January 2, 2008 and is used by state residential mortgage regulators to process licenses by mortgage lenders, brokers and/or professionals. In 2009, SRR launched NMLS Consumer Access, an online public database disclosing the licensing information of firms and individuals, which will eventually include any state enforcement history.
